The launch of the Vote Leave campaign in Cumbria is to take place on Monday April 18.

A debate called, “Why Vote Leave” is to be held at Cartmel Race Course at Grange-over-Sands, beginning at 7pm.

Speakers include the race course owner, Lord Cavendish; John Stanyer, North West chairman of UKIP; David Campbell Bannerman, Conservative MEP and Paul White, regional organiser of Vote Leave.

“This will be an excellent opportunity to hear why we we need to take back control of our lives and spend our money on our priorities,” said Mr Stanyer.
